21/06/2009 - CG-Lock Finalist at 2009 BRAKE Awards
With over 35 ‘saved lives’ the CG-Lock is helping to reduce deaths and injuries on roads all over the world.
Crash tests demonstrate that the device does not adversely affect the safety of the seatbelt, indeed the data suggest that it enhances seatbelt safety.
The road safety charity ‘Brake’ (www.brake.org.uk) has recognised the impact on safety the CG-Lock is making and has selected the device into the finals of the innovation awards to be held in June.
“This is a great acknowledgement that the device is really helping to reduce injury and save lives” commented the Company Chairman Ron Cox, “when you read the testimonials and letters of thanks from vehicle crash survivors it really energises us to continue to bring this product to the wider public” he continues.
Lap Belt Cinch is currently short listing major companies to exclusively market and sell the device for the booster seat market where it adds significant stability to children travelling and eliminates seatbelt ‘ejection’ by holding the children in securely.
